Collier Heights Elementary School serves 466 students in grades Prekindergarten-5.
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 was equal to the Georgia state level of 14:1.

Frequently Asked Questions
How many students attend Collier Heights Elementary School?
466 students attend Collier Heights Elementary School.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
100% of Collier Heights Elementary School students are Black.
What is the student-teacher ratio of Collier Heights Elementary School?
Collier Heights Elementary School has a student ration of 14:1, which is equal to the Georgia state average of 14:1.
What grades does Collier Heights Elementary School offer ?
Collier Heights Elementary School offers enrollment in grades Prekindergarten-5
What school district is Collier Heights Elementary School part of?
Collier Heights Elementary School is part of Atlanta Public Schools.
